Goodwill Tornado Relief - 2nd & 4th Saturdays Each Month
posted over 7 years ago by ssteffes
The Goodwill Tornado Relief Distribution Site at 1320 W. Reno in OKC will be open to tornado survivors on the 2nd and 4th Saturday of each month beginning July 13 from 10am-3pm, no appointment necessary. Recipients MUST present ID and a referral sheet from the Red Cross, FEMA, Catholic Charities, Salvation Army, Goodwill or St. Vincent de Paul.
There is an abundance of gently used and new items available for those affected: clothing, shoes, baby items, paper goods, food, water, pet items, small household appliances, etc.
Appointments for other times may be made by emailing your contact info and desired appointment date/time to ssteffes@okgoodwill.org. Volunteers are needed as well for these events.
